Perfect St Austell Base
You know what really struck me about this location? It’s genuinely useful for exploring everything Cornwall has to offer. St Austell isn’t just a stopover — you’re perfectly positioned for the Eden Project (which is basically next door), but also close enough to nip down to the coast when you fancy some sea air. The couples who rate this place so highly (8.4 out of 10, apparently) probably figured out what I did — you can actually walk to decent pubs and shops without getting back in the car every five minutes. That’s rarer than you’d think in this part of Cornwall, where many accommodations leave you feeling isolated from local amenities and attractions.

Breakfast Worth Getting Up For
I’ll be honest — I’m usually pretty skeptical about hotel breakfast claims, but The Royal Inn actually delivers on their promises with impressive consistency. They’ve got the full English sorted, obviously, but what impressed me was how well they handle the alternatives. Proper vegetarian options, decent vegan choices, and they clearly understand gluten-free requirements beyond just offering sad toast. The continental selection isn’t an afterthought either — fresh fruit, proper pastries, good coffee that actually tastes like coffee. It’s the kind of breakfast that sets you up for a day exploring without leaving you feeling heavy or unsatisfied.
